ISLAMABAD - Railways Minister Khawaja Saad Rafique has launched Kohat-Rawalpindi Rail Car service.

Addressing inaugural ceremony in Kohat on Wednesday, he said the rail car service, which had been suspended since 2011, has been re-launched at a cost of over three hundred and sixty million rupees.

The Minister said state of the art facilities have been provided at railway stations across the country to facilitate the passengers.
